Decoding the "Business Casual" Denim Dilemma
The term "business casual" can be notoriously ambiguous. What one company deems acceptable, another might consider too informal. When it comes to jeans, this ambiguity often translates to a few key considerations:
- Wash: Darker washes are generally your safest bet. Avoid overly distressed, ripped, faded, or acid-washed denim. Think deep indigo, black, or charcoal grey. These sophisticated hues mimic the look of traditional trousers, instantly elevating your denim.
- Fit: A well-fitting pair of jeans is paramount. Overly tight, baggy, or ill-fitting styles can detract from your professional image. Straight-leg, bootcut, and even some well-tailored skinny jeans can work, depending on your personal style and workplace culture.
- Fabric: Look for denim with a good amount of stretch and recovery. This ensures comfort throughout your workday and that your jeans maintain their shape. A blend of cotton with elastane or spandex is ideal.
- Details: Keep embellishments to a minimum. Steer clear of excessive pockets, rivets, or loud stitching. Clean lines and subtle details are key to a polished look.

1. The Classic Straight-Leg Jean: An Unbeatable Workhorse
When you think of the best jeans for work women, the straight-leg cut often comes to mind. This enduring style is a true testament to versatility. Its clean, uncluttered silhouette offers a smooth line from hip to hem, making it incredibly easy to dress up or down.
- Why it Works: The straight-leg cut is universally flattering and provides a comfortable, non-restrictive fit. It doesn’t cling too tightly to the leg, offering a more polished appearance than some ultra-skinny styles. When paired with a blazer, a crisp blouse, or a sophisticated knit, it creates an effortlessly chic ensemble.
- Fabric Recommendations: Opt for a mid-weight denim with a touch of stretch for maximum comfort and shape retention. Dark indigo or black washes are ideal for a professional setting.
- Styling Tips:
- For a polished look: Pair with pointed-toe heels or loafers, a tucked-in silk blouse, and a tailored blazer.
- For a slightly more relaxed vibe: Combine with a fine-gauge knit sweater and stylish ankle boots.
- Ensure the hem hits at the right spot: The hem should ideally graze the top of your shoe or be just long enough to create a slight break on your footwear.
2. The Sophisticated Bootcut Jean: A Touch of Classic Elegance
The bootcut jean, with its subtle flare at the ankle, offers a touch of classic elegance that is perfectly suited for professional environments. This style has made a triumphant return, proving its enduring appeal for the best jeans for work women.
- Why it Works: The bootcut silhouette balances out the hips and thighs, creating a flattering hourglass shape. The slight flare at the hem is designed to accommodate boots, but it also pairs beautifully with heels and even some flats, adding a touch of polish to your outfit.
- Fabric Recommendations: Similar to straight-leg jeans, a dark wash with a hint of stretch is your best bet. Look for a fabric that drapes well without being too heavy.
- Styling Tips:
- The Power Pairing: This style is a dream with heels, especially block heels or wedges, as the flare helps to elongate the leg.
- Top it Off: Pair with a flowy blouse, a fitted cardigan, or a structured button-down shirt.
- Consider the length: The hem should ideally cover most of your boot or heel to achieve the intended leg-lengthening effect.
3. The Tailored Skinny Jean: A Modern Professional Edge
While "skinny" might initially sound too casual, a well-tailored, dark-wash skinny jean can absolutely be one of the best jeans for work women, especially in more contemporary office settings. The key here is fit and the absence of any overly trendy or distressed elements.
- Why it Works: A properly fitted skinny jean can create a sleek, streamlined silhouette that pairs beautifully with a variety of tops and outerwear. They offer a modern, sharp look that can feel incredibly confident and stylish.
- Fabric Recommendations: Prioritize denim with excellent stretch and recovery. You want them to hold their shape and not become saggy throughout the day. Dark indigo, black, or deep charcoal are essential.
- Styling Tips:
- The Balancing Act: To maintain a professional aesthetic, pair skinny jeans with looser-fitting tops like oversized blazers, flowy tunics, or relaxed-fit blouses. This creates a harmonious balance.
- Footwear Finesse: Ankle boots, pointed-toe flats, or heels all work well with skinny jeans.
- Avoid Over-Stretching: Ensure the jeans are fitted but not uncomfortably tight. You should be able to move freely without feeling constricted.
4. The Polished Wide-Leg or Flare Jean: A Statement of Sophistication
For those seeking a bolder yet still incredibly chic option among the best jeans for work women, the wide-leg or flare jean can be a revelation. These styles offer a sophisticated and on-trend silhouette that can elevate your professional wardrobe.
- Why it Works: The dramatic silhouette of wide-leg and flare jeans creates a sense of elegance and polish. They offer a comfortable and forgiving fit while exuding a high-fashion appeal. When styled correctly, they can easily replace trousers.
- Fabric Recommendations: Look for denim with a good drape. A heavier weight denim can provide structure, while a lighter blend can offer a more fluid movement. Dark washes are still the most appropriate for work.
- Styling Tips:
- The Power of Proportion: Balance the volume of wide-leg or flare jeans with more fitted tops. A tucked-in blouse, a sleek turtleneck, or a fitted knit will prevent the look from becoming overwhelming.
- Elevate with Footwear: These styles demand a shoe with some height to maintain the desired silhouette. Heels, wedges, or platform shoes are excellent choices.
- Hemming is Crucial: Ensure your wide-leg or flare jeans are hemmed to the correct length to avoid them dragging on the floor.

Fabric and Stretch: The Comfort Equation
The fabric of your jeans plays a monumental role in their suitability for the workplace.
- Cotton-Rich Blends: A high percentage of cotton provides breathability and a classic denim feel. However, pure cotton can lack stretch, leading to a less comfortable experience throughout the day.
- The Magic of Elastane/Spandex: Look for jeans with 1-3% elastane or spandex. This small addition makes a world of difference, offering flexibility, comfort, and shape retention. They move with you, not against you.
- Denim Weight: Mid-weight denim (around 10-13 oz) is often the sweet spot for workwear. It’s substantial enough to hold its shape and provide a polished look without feeling heavy or restrictive. Lighter weights can sometimes look too casual.
The Art of the Dark Wash: Professionalism Personified
When it comes to work-appropriate denim, the wash is paramount.
- Deep Indigo: The classic dark indigo wash is a universally accepted choice for professional settings. It’s sophisticated, versatile, and mimics the appearance of dark trousers.
- Black and Charcoal Grey: These darker hues offer an equally polished alternative to indigo. Black jeans are especially versatile and can be dressed up for more formal occasions.
- Avoid the Faded and Distressed: Steer clear of any jeans that are heavily faded, bleached, ripped, torn, or feature excessive whiskering. These elements are generally too casual for most professional environments.
Fit is King (or Queen!): Tailoring for Triumph
The fit of your jeans is non-negotiable when aiming for the best jeans for work women.
- The Mid-Rise Advantage: Mid-rise jeans tend to be the most universally flattering and comfortable for a work setting. They sit at a natural point on the waist, offering good coverage and a secure feel.
- Avoid Too High or Too Low: Very low-rise jeans can be problematic for bending and movement, while extremely high-waisted styles might feel too fashion-forward for some workplaces.
- The Importance of Tailoring: Don’t underestimate the power of a good tailor. Even a small adjustment to the hem or waist can transform a decent pair of jeans into the best jeans for work women for your specific body type.

The Blazer Brigade: Instant Professionalism
A well-fitting blazer is your secret weapon for instantly elevating any pair of work-appropriate jeans.
- Classic Neutrals: Invest in blazers in classic colors like black, navy, grey, or camel. These will pair seamlessly with your denim.
- Structured Silhouettes: Opt for blazers with clean lines and a good structure. This adds polish and authority to your look.
- The Tuck-In Triumph: Always tuck in your top when wearing a blazer with jeans. This creates a defined waistline and a more sophisticated finish.
The Power of the Blouse: From Silky Smooth to Crisp Cotton
Your choice of top can dramatically alter the formality of your jeans.
- Silk and Satin Blouses: These luxurious fabrics instantly dress up denim, adding a touch of elegance.
- Crisp Button-Downs: A classic white or light blue button-down shirt is a timeless choice that always looks professional.
- Fine-Gauge Knits: Opt for high-quality knit sweaters in fine yarns like merino wool or cashmere. Avoid chunky, oversized knits for the office.
Footwear Finesse: Completing the Look
The right shoes can make or break your entire outfit.
- Pointed-Toe Heels or Flats: These classic styles elongate the leg and add a polished touch to any denim ensemble.
- Stylish Loafers: A sophisticated pair of loafers offers comfort and a timeless professional aesthetic.
- Chic Ankle Boots: Ankle boots with a heel or a sleek, pointed toe can be a fantastic option, especially with straight-leg or skinny jeans.

- Observe and Adapt: Take cues from your colleagues and superiors. If most people are wearing suits, err on the side of caution. If denim is common, you have more flexibility.
- When in Doubt, Dress Up: It’s always better to be slightly overdressed than underdressed. If you’re unsure, choose a darker wash, a more structured silhouette, and pair it with polished separates.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q1: What is the absolute most important factor when choosing jeans for work?
A1: The wash is arguably the most crucial factor. Opt for dark, solid washes like deep indigo, black, or charcoal grey. Avoid any rips, tears, or excessive fading.
Q2: Can I wear ripped jeans to work?
A2: Generally, no. Unless your workplace has a very casual dress code, ripped or distressed jeans are typically considered too informal for a professional environment.
Q3: What shoe styles are best with work jeans?
A3: Classic choices include pointed-toe heels, sophisticated loafers, chic ankle boots, and elegant flats. The key is to choose footwear that adds polish to your ensemble.
Q4: Are skinny jeans appropriate for work?
A4: Yes, a well-tailored, dark-wash skinny jean can be perfectly appropriate for work, especially in more modern office settings. Pair them with looser-fitting tops or blazers to maintain a balanced and professional look.
Q5: How can I make sure my jeans are comfortable enough for a full workday?
A5: Look for jeans with a blend of cotton and stretch (1-3% elastane or spandex). This provides flexibility and shape retention, ensuring comfort throughout the day. A mid-weight denim is also often ideal.
